First-Line Supervisor of Construction Trades and Extraction Worker Salary in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ma

The annual salary statistics of first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ma is shown in Table 1. The wage statistics of first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ers in Oklahoma City is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].

Table 1. Annual Salary of First-Line Supervisors of Construction Trades and Extraction Workers in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ma

Percentile BracketAverage Annual Salary
10th Percentile Wage
$43,400
25th Percentile Wage
$51,520
50th Percentile Wage
$73,270
75th Percentile Wage
$86,680
90th Percentile Wage
$110,090

Table 1 shows the average annual salary for first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$110,090.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$73,270.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$43,400.

Table 2. Compare First-Line Supervisor of Construction Trades and Extraction Worker Salary in Oklahoma City with Other Oklahoma Cities

From Table 3 we note that with a median annual salary of $73,270, Oklahoma City is the highest paying city for first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ers in state of Oklahoma, followed by Southwestern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area (median annual salary $67,620). In comparison, the median annual salary of first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ers in Oklahoma City is 7.7 percent (7.7%) higher than that in Southwestern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area.

Cities/Areas Median Annual Salary
Oklahoma City
$73,270
Southwestern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area
$67,620
Tulsa
$66,560
Northwestern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area
$64,150
Lawton
$63,700
Southeastern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area
$60,210
Enid
$59,570
Northeastern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area
$59,510
Fort Smith
$56,380
